Standard Tire Size for the Sonata Sport 2.0 T
The standard tire size for the 2015 Hyundai Sonata Sport 2.0 T is 245/45R18. This size is specifically chosen to complement the vehicle’s handling characteristics and aesthetic appeal. Here’s a breakdown of what those numbers mean:
- 245: This is the tire’s width in millimeters. A wider tire can provide better grip and stability.
- 45: This is the aspect ratio, which indicates the height of the tire sidewall as a percentage of the width. A lower ratio typically means better handling.
- R: This indicates that the tire is of radial construction, which is standard for most modern vehicles.
- 18: This is the diameter of the wheel in inches that the tire is designed to fit.
Different Trims and Their Tire Sizes
The Sonata comes in various trims, and while the Sport 2.0 T has its standard size, other trims may vary. Here’s a quick look at the tire sizes across different trims:
Trim Level | Tire Size | Wheel Size |
---|---|---|
Base Model | 215/55R17 | 17 inches |
Sport 2.0 T | 245/45R18 | 18 inches |
Limited | 225/45R18 | 18 inches |
Why Tire Size Matters
Choosing the right tire size is not just about aesthetics; it’s about performance, safety, and fuel efficiency. Here are a few reasons why you should pay attention to tire size:
- Handling: The correct tire size ensures that your vehicle handles well, especially during cornering and sudden maneuvers.
- Fuel Efficiency: Tires that are too wide or too narrow can affect your car’s fuel consumption. Stick to the recommended size for optimal performance.
- Safety: Using the wrong tire size can lead to issues such as poor traction, increased stopping distances, and even tire blowouts.

Common Alternate Tire Sizes
If you’re considering switching up your tire size, here are a few alternate sizes that owners have successfully used on the Sonata Sport 2.0 T:
- 225/50R18
- 235/45R18
- 255/40R18
Each of these sizes can offer distinct advantages depending on your driving style and conditions.
225/50R18
This size is slightly narrower than the standard and can provide a smoother ride. It is often favored by those who prioritize comfort over aggressive handling.
235/45R18
This size is a middle ground, offering a balance between comfort and performance. It can provide improved cornering stability while still maintaining a comfortable ride.
255/40R18
If you’re looking for a more performance-oriented tire, this wider size can give you better grip during aggressive driving. However, be cautious as it may also lead to a stiffer ride.
Best Tire Models Based on Owner Feedback
When it comes to selecting the best tires for your Sonata Sport 2.0 T, owner feedback and forum discussions can provide valuable insights. Here are some of the top-rated tire models that have garnered positive reviews:
- Michelin Pilot Sport A/S 3+
- Bridgestone Potenza RE980AS
- Goodyear Eagle Sport All-Season
- Continental ExtremeContact DWS06
- Pirelli Cinturato P7 All Season Plus
Michelin Pilot Sport A/S 3+
This tire is known for its exceptional performance in both wet and dry conditions. Owners rave about its handling and responsiveness, making it a favorite for those who enjoy spirited driving.
Bridgestone Potenza RE980AS
Another solid choice, the Potenza RE980AS is praised for its balance of comfort and performance. It provides excellent grip and stability, especially during cornering, which is crucial for a sporty sedan.
Goodyear Eagle Sport All-Season
This tire is often recommended for its all-around performance. Owners appreciate its durability and the ability to handle various weather conditions without compromising on comfort.
Continental ExtremeContact DWS06
This tire is a popular option for those who want a performance tire that can handle winter conditions. It’s known for its outstanding wet traction and long tread life, making it a versatile choice.
Pirelli Cinturato P7 All Season Plus
If fuel efficiency is a priority, the Pirelli Cinturato P7 is often highlighted for its low rolling resistance. It provides a comfortable ride and is suitable for daily driving.
Owner Insights and Recommendations
When discussing tire options, owners on forums often emphasize the importance of considering your driving habits and local conditions. Here are some key takeaways:
- For daily driving and commuting, all-season tires are typically the best choice.
- If you live in an area with harsh winters, consider dedicated winter tires for improved safety and performance.
- Regularly check tire pressure and tread depth to ensure optimal performance and safety.
- Rotate your tires every 5,000 to 7,500 miles to promote even wear.
